JSP的四大域物件 九大內建物件及對應作用

2021-09-11 10:27:46 字數 1036 閱讀 4069

(1)pagecontextpage 域-指當前頁面,在當前 jsp 頁面有效,跳到其它頁面失效

(2)requestrequest 域-指一次請求範圍內有效,從 http 請求到伺服器處理結束,返回響應的整個過程。 在這個過程中使用 forward(請求**)方式跳轉多個 jsp,在這些頁面裡你都可以使用這個變數

(3)sessionsession 域-指當前會話有效範圍,瀏覽器從開啟到關閉過程中,**、重定向均可以使用 感恩於心,回報於行。 

生命週期作用域作用

request一次請求

只在 jsp 頁面內 有效

用於接受通過 http 協議傳送到伺服器 的資料(包括頭資訊、系統資訊、請 求方式以及請求引數等)。

reponse一次請求

只在 jsp 頁面內 有效

表示伺服器端對客戶端的回應。主要 用於設定頭資訊、跳轉、cookie 等

session從存入資料開始,預設閒置 30 分鐘後失效

會話內有效

用於儲存特定的使用者會話所需的資訊

out

用於在 web 瀏覽器內輸出資訊,並且管理應用伺服器上的輸出緩衝區

pagecontext

page

page 物件代表 jsp 本身(對應 this), 只有在 jsp 頁面內才是合法的

exception

顯示異常資訊,必須在 page 指令中設 定< %@ page iserrorpage="true" %>才能 使用,在一般的 jsp 頁面中使用該物件 將無法編譯 jsp 檔案

config

取得伺服器的配置資訊

jsp九大內建物件 jsp四大域物件

九大內建物件 內建物件 就是沒有宣告就可以使用的物件 request httpservletrequest物件,代表客戶端請求資訊,用於接收http傳送到服務端的資料 response httpservletresponse物件,代表客戶端的響應。幾乎不用 session httpsession物件...

jsp之九大內建物件與四大域物件

在jsp開發中會頻繁使用到一些物件,如servletcontext httpsession pagecontext等.如果每次我們在jsp頁面中需要使用這些物件都要自己親自動手建立就會特別的繁瑣.sun公司因此在設計jsp時,在jsp頁面載入完畢之後自動幫開發者建立好了這些物件,開發者只需要使用相應...

jsp之九大內建物件與四大域物件

一,什麼是內建物件?在jsp開發中會頻繁使用到一些物件,如servletcontext httpsession pagecontext等.如果每次我們在jsp頁面中需要使用這些物件都要自己親自動手建立就會特別的繁瑣.sun公司因此在設計jsp時,在jsp頁面載入完畢之後自動幫開發者建立好了這些物件,...